ABS Problem on '97 Cavalier
I have a '97 Cavalier which is the third vehicle in our family and therefore gets little use. The car recently started engaging the ABS while you applying the brakes at a certain speed - around 10mph and then stops as the vehicle comes to a stop which, I guessing, is a sensor problem. Does anyone have experience as to how much cost is involved in repairing this or is it possible to simply disconnect the ABS on this vehicle?
